Another DHS meeting

A meeting is now underway seeking potential paths for ending the shutdown of the Department of Homeland Security. Tom Homan, President Donald Trump’s border czar, is meeting with top Senate appropriators and other key senators. It’s the second meeting of the same group in as many days.
